Frequently Asked Questions about Bay City
How much are Studio apartments in Bay City?
There are currently 9 Studio Apartments in Bay City with rent ranges from $699 to $1,066 with an average price of $844.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Bay City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Bay City ranges from $700 to $1,070 with an average monthly rent of $908.
